Clearwater was not able to break out of their rough patch on Sunday as the team picked up their sixth straight defeat. They might be feeling deja-vu: they lost 10-0 to the Senath-Hornersville Lions, which was the same score (and result) they got the week prior. Unfortunately, that's the third time they've come up short against the Lions this season, with their most recent loss being a 13-3 defeat on Sunday.
Clearwater's loss dropped their record down to 7-21. As for Senath-Hornersville, the win (which was their third in a row) raised their record to 9-14.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: the Lions beat Clearwater by a score of 13-3 later that day.
